The
World Disasters Report 2009
focuses on disaster risk reduction under the title
Early Warning Early Action.
The report emphasizes the need to invest in a culture of prevention. Early action is portrayed as an investment for the future and far more effective in the long run being perpetually caught up in a reactive cycle of disaster response.
Early warning early action also promotes harnessing existing knowledge and technologies and translating this into life-saving measures for populations at risk. The report also focuses on the importance of working in partnership with governments and local communities, to effectively shift emphasis towards more preventive action.
